Enabling Dynamic Stroke Feature
To enable the Dynamic Strokes feature a specific resource is required first.
Finding Dynamic Strokes compatible resources
When browsing the Assets window, a dedicated icon at the bottom right of a thumbnail indicates the compatibility type of the resource. If there is no icon visible it means the resource can’t take advantage of the feature.
This resource can use one or more of the following behaviors :
- Stamp Index
- Time
- Random Seed
It is also possible to search resources by using the search field in the Shelf with the following keywords :
- dynamicstroke
- randomseed
Dynamic Strokes parameters
When a Dynamic Stroke resource has been loaded a new list of parameters is added just before the Substance parameter group.
Only available if the resource has the dynamic control “Stamp Index”. Indicates from which value the index of the stamps inside the brush stroke should start from :
- From beginning (0): Default. Index starts from zero at each new stroke.
- From Random Index: Index starts from a random value (with its maximum defined by the Stamp Cycle Count). Note that the following values will still be in sequence and not fully random.
Only available if the resource has the dynamic control “Random Seed”. Controls how the Random Seed should change:
- Single: Default. Use a single Random Seed value which can be manually set via the Substance parameters.
- Random Per Stroke: Generates a new Random Seed value for each new brush stroke.
- Random Per Stamp: Generates a new Random Seed value for each stamp inside a brush stroke. Be careful with parameter as it can be very expensive.
